Kenyan Athletes Aim for Titles at Championships in Tokyo - September 2025

Kenya aims to reclaim its dominance in the men's marathon and 10,000m at the 2025 Tokyo World Athletics Champions, with a four-man marathon team and a trio in the 10,000m. At the same championships in Tokyo, Japan, three-time world champion Faith Kipyegon made a strong start in the women's 1500m heats, showing her intention to defend her title. Separately, Deaflympics champion Ian Wambui Kahinga has qualified for the 25th Summer Deaflympics in Tokyo, Japan, set for November 15-26, 2025. After winning the men's 10,000m at the national trials in Nairobi, Kahinga is aiming for triple gold in Tokyo.

Key Highlights

Kenya aims to reclaim its dominance in men's marathon and 10,000m at the 2025 Tokyo World Athletics Champions. A four-man team will compete in the marathon, while a trio will challenge for gold in the 10,000m.

  • The marathon team includes Vincent Ngetich, Erick Sang, Kennedy Kimutai, and Hillary Kipkoech, with the race starting at 1.30am Sunday Kenyan time.
  • The 10,000m squad, featuring Benson Kiplangat, Ishmael Rokitto Kipkurui, and Edwin Kurgat, seeks to end a long gold medal drought, last achieved by Charles Kimathi in 2001.
  • Kenya last won a men's marathon medal, a bronze by Amos Kipruto, in 2019.

Key Highlights

Deaflympics champion Ian Wambui Kahinga has qualified for the 25th Summer Deaflympics in Tokyo, Japan, set for November 15-26, 2025, after winning the men's 10,000m at the national trials in Nairobi. He aims for triple gold in Tokyo.

  • Kahinga won the 10,000m with a time of 30:46.5, beating newcomer Peter Rutto (30:47.5).
  • He previously won gold in the 1500m and silver in the 5000m at the last Deaflympics.
  • The 24-year-old trained for three years in his remote Nyahururu village, perfecting speed and endurance, and plans to emulate his role model, Eliud Kipchoge.
